Introduction
NetUP Streamer HDMI 1x – is an encoding device for IP broadcasting. It can receive signal from an
STB, PC, TV, etc., and broadcast a live stream through the Internet or LAN. The live stream then can be
received on a PC, phone, tablet, etc. NetUP Streamer HDMI 1x lets one access an IP STB, PC or TV
anywhere, whether in the same building or across the globe. You will never miss a game or a favorite
show.
The device accepts signal from HDMI sources and encodes it to MPEG 4 AVC/H.264, it broadcasts the
output signal over UDP (unicast/multicast), RTMP or HLS. NetUP Streamer HDMI 1x is also capable of
writing output stream to a USB drive as TS files and broadcasting from those files later.

Grounding requirement
•Connect the ground wire to the grounding hardware on the device. Ground resistance should be
no more than 1 Ω.
Grounding is essential for device’s functionality, surge and electronic interference
protection
•Keep proper contact with the metal housing of the device
•Grounding wire must be made out of copper and as thick and short as possible
•Make sure the two ends of grounding wire conduct electricity and are not rusty
•It is prohibited to use any other devices as a part of grounding electric circuit
•All racks should be connected with a protective copper strip. Ground loops should be avoided
•Grounding wire’s contact area with the rack should be no less than 25mm2

WEB NMS Operation
Use the Web interface to control NetUP Streamer HDMI 1x.
Login
Connect a personal computer and the device with net cable, and use ping command to confirm they
are on the same network segment.
Make sure that the computer’s IP address is different from the device’s IP address;
otherwise, it would cause an IP conflict
The default IP address of NetUP Streamer HDMI 1x is 192.168.200.64. Thus, set the computer’s IP
address to 192.168.200.X, where X can be from 0 to 255, except 64. Open a web browser, enter the
device’s IP address in the browser address bar and press Enter. If the network is configured correctly,
you will see the login interface (Figure 1).
Enter username and password and click LOGIN to enter the web interface. Default username is
“admin”, default password is “admin”.

Param setting
NetUP Streamer HDMI 1x supports up to three output streams simultaneously (different bitrate,
resolution, protocol, etc.). Use the Param setting page to access the encoding and broadcasting
settings of each of the three available output streams (Figure-3).

Save/Restore config
Use the Save/Restore config page to save current settings or restore from saved ones or from factory
settings. The encoder applies saved settings after each reboot, therefore discarding any unsaved
changes (Figure-4).
Figure-4
Backup/Load config
Use the Backup/Load config page to download current configuration and save it on a local storage
device. It also allows you to restore settings from a local file (Figure-5).
